i think this would be one of the most differently done tricks. cause somepeople do more of a bs 180 and add another shuv which looks the best in my opinion cause its more even and then a bunch of people do the 3 shuv and spin there body at the end. i cant do them but i would work on bs 180's all day and i would bet that would help the landing. maybe even work on landing bs 180's blind without the handle pass if you think you might want to do teh bigspin without it at first

always pass the handle. it helps with the landing plus it looks ten times better.

once you get the balance of staying over it and keeping the board with you, the main issue is the landing, cause its easy to slip out on your switch heels when you do it. so to help with the landing, some good tips would be to:

1. lead with your hips before you even pop it
2. look for your landing with your head then look out once you land to get your hips behind you
3. (after passing the handle) push it back behind you to get over your toes

its a lot to think about, but its kind of a 'feel' trick. just keep those things in mind and youll start to do them more naturally without having to put so much thought into it every time, hopefully.

your situation could be different, but that helped me.
